Old Towne sits on the west side of Greensboro, where mature trees, sidewalks, and thoughtful streetscapes create an easygoing pace without sacrificing convenience. Weekends often start with a coffee and an errand run at the open-air Friendly Center, then a quiet loop through the lush boardwalks of The Bog Garden or a picnic at nearby parks. Families appreciate how close Old Towne is to cultural staples and kid-friendly fun, from hands-on exhibits at the Greensboro Science Center to neighborhood festivals in adjacent Lindley Park.
Public education is anchored by Guilford County Schools, known for magnet, STEM, and IB pathways, plus robust arts and athletics. Higher education adds energy and resources to the area; the University of North Carolina at Greensboro and other local campuses bring lectures, performances, and continuing-ed opportunities within a short drive. Being part of Guilford County also means extensive parks, libraries, and recreation programming throughout the year.
Commuting is straightforward, with major corridors connecting Old Towne to employment centers and downtown venues for concerts, theater, and dining.
